Samsung 970 PRO M.2 512GB NVMe SSD review




In this review we examine the Samsung 970 PRO M2 SSD, the new SSD offers faster performance and increased TBW values compared to the 960 series. The new M.2 Pro units will be the most popular ones for the professional desktop enthusiast end-users, it can be purchased in volume sizes up-to 1TB. NVMe Storage technology is advancing with extremely fast paces and steps.

Saying the 970 can do 3500mb/s is great but actual read speeds will be considerably lower after populating the drive, I have a 960 pro 512gb, ok so when i got the drive it did read at 3400mb/s but after migrating my Windows 10 it soon fell off, I currently have 81gb free from the available 428gb and i get just under 2400mb/s seq read/1800mb/s seq write, so i think poputaled drive speeds should be used instead for comparison.
